County Council - Tuesday, 21 July 2026 - 10.00 am

The County Council met on Tuesday 21 July 2026 to discuss a range of important issues, with the primary focus being a debate on the council's approach to climate change. After extensive discussion and an amendment, the council voted to repeal its previous climate emergency declaration and establish a new cross-party working group to focus on practical environmental priorities. The meeting also addressed concerns regarding pavement parking, support for young people not in education, employment, or training (NEET), the future of Healthwatch, and safeguarding arrangements for children.

Staff and Pensions Committee - Monday, 8 June 2026 - 10.00 am

The Staff and Pensions Committee of Warwickshire Council met on Monday 8 June 2026 to discuss the Local Government Pension Scheme (LGPS) governance, pension administration, and amendments to the Firefighters' Pension Scheme. Key decisions included the renaming of the Pension Fund Investment Sub-Committee to the LGPS Pension Fund Sub-Committee and the delegation of LGPS functions to it, alongside approving amendments to the Firefighters' Pension Scheme member contribution structure.

AGM, County Council - Thursday 14 May 2026 10.00 am

Councillor Dale Keeling was elected as the new Chair of Warwickshire County Council, securing 33 votes to Councillor Kate Rolfe's 21. Councillor Luke Shingler was subsequently elected as Vice-Chair, with 30 votes to Councillor Judy Phelps's 24. The Council also adopted its new four-year Council Plan, Recalibrating Warwickshire, following a lengthy debate and the rejection of two amendments.

Restore Britain Group Motion

From: County Council - Tuesday 17 March 2026 10.00 am - March 17, 2026

The County Council of Warwickshire Council approved recommendations on 17/03/2026. The council resolved to engage with public organisations to support local farmers and game dealers, support sustainable shooting on council land, and ask officers to explore how shooting and conservation can help achieve environmental targets and improve opportunities for young people. Officers will also provide information on deer in road traffic collisions and consider a deer management plan. The council will write to local MPs requesting support for British farmers and sustainable shooting.
